none
Создание копии базы для отчетности RRS feed

  • Вопрос

  • Приветствую всех!

    SQL 2008R2, база 40Гб.

    Появилась задача создать на другом сервере актуальную копию БД, для построения отчетов.

    База отчетности не должна отставать от оригинала более чем на 2 часа, можно меньше.

    Из возможных решений вижу 2 пути - Log Shipping & Transactional Replication.

    Log Shipping - основной минус в том, что в момент обновления базы все активные пользователи отключаются, что не очень удобно.

    Transactional Replication - тут вижу сложность в том, что реплицируется не вся база, а лишь выбранные таблицы + сложность настройки/поддержки.

    Хотелоcь бы услышать Ваше мнение/рекомендации, какой механизм наиболее надежен?

    Возможно, в 2012 есть подходящее решение, обновиться до 2012 можем.

    P.S.В идеале это полная копия базы, не отстающая сильно от оригинала и не отключающая пользователей в момент обновления. 


    MCSE, MCSA:Messaging (2000/2003) MCITP:EMA, MCTS: Exchange 2007





    5 октября 2012 г. 5:49

Ответы

Все ответы